Transaction 07aaffddca6857a811d3127a741b0a4c3ef841682ae3f95f4322376ff3615b8d

1 Input
2 Outputs
  • 07aaffddca6857a811d3127a741b0a4c3ef841682ae3f95f4322376ff3615b8d:0
  • value  1475200
    address  1A3ZTdsLJRXSWkgE9GSVAugtEtvzAjp6TH
  • 07aaffddca6857a811d3127a741b0a4c3ef841682ae3f95f4322376ff3615b8d:1
  • value  12597521
    address  3DWPpkcao4iu65mMoKpjxrxdWVhCy34BxJ